Latest Patents
Song Feng Mo holds a patent titled "Environmental controls for operation of an electrostatographic developer unit having multiple magnetic brush rolls." This invention presents a sophisticated development station designed to improve toner halftone dot development across a wide variety of environmental conditions. The patent outlines a developer housing that retains semi-conductive carrier particles and toner particles, incorporating a first magnetic roll and a second magnetic roll—both equipped with stationary cores and sleeves featuring longitudinal grooves. The invention is invaluable for its inclusion of an environmental sensor that generates signals related to environmental conditions, enabling a variable voltage supply to be adjusted accordingly for optimal performance.
